为何在使用postgresql时,无法正确显示数据库表详细信息?
如何通过命令查看数据库列表
1、图形界面:通过 SQL Server Management Studio (SSMS) 的 对象资源管理器 直接查看所有数据库,无需命令。T-SQL命令:执行 SELECT name FROM master.dbo.sysdatabases; 可查询数据库列表。常见问题:习惯命令行操作的用户可能忽略图形界面的便捷性。

2、如何查看数据库列表?mysql:show databases;postgresql:\l;sqlite:.databases;microsoft sql server:select name from sys.databases;oracle:select database_name from v$database。
3、查看特定数据库中的表需先通过USE 数据库名;切换到目标数据库,再执行SHOW TABLES;。若未切换数据库直接执行SHOW TABLES;会报错,需注意操作上下文。示例:USE test_db;SHOW TABLES;查看表结构使用DESCRIBE 表名;或简写DESC 表名;,可显示字段名称、数据类型、是否允许为空等信息。
pgadmin如何找数据库表
1、打开目标数据库启动pgAdmin后,在左侧浏览器面板中找到并双击需要操作的数据库名称,进入该数据库管理界面。 展开架构选项在数据库管理界面中,找到Schemas(架构)选项并点击左侧的展开箭头(+),显示该数据库下的所有架构。
2、方法一:通过表属性查看列属性打开pgAdmin,在左侧导航面板中展开目标数据库的架构(Schemas)选项。定位目标表:在架构下找到表(Tables),展开后选择需要查看的表。右键选择属性:右键点击目标表,从上下文菜单中选择属性(Properties)。
3、点击确定后大家便可以查看postsql已有的数据库了; 注:pgAdmin3的数据库和查询一个表; 1 SELECT; 要从一个表中检索数据就是查询这个表。
linux下如何查看数据库
1、在Linux下查看数据库,可以通过以下几种方法实现:使用命令行工具 查看MySQL数据库 在Linux终端中,使用命令mysql -u用户名 -p,然后输入密码,即可进入MySQL的命令行界面。在MySQL命令行界面中,输入SHOW DATABASES;命令,即可查看所有数据库的列表。
2、在Linux系统中,查看数据库版本信息的方法主要有以下几种:使用终端命令:在Linux终端中输入mysql V,即可直接查看MySQL数据库的版本信息。例如:[shengting@login~]$ mysql V。通过MySQL命令行界面的status命令:登录到MySQL命令行界面,然后输入status;并执行,系统会输出当前数据库的状态信息,包括版本信息。

3、查看系统服务文件:通过systemctl status mysql或systemctl status mysqld命令查看MySQL服务的配置,输出的信息中可能会包含MySQL的安装目录。对于PostgreSQL:查看配置文件:PostgreSQL的主要配置文件是postgresql.conf,这个文件中包含了数据库文件的存放路径。可以通过查找这个文件来找到数据目录的设置。
怎么把sql文件导入postgresql数据库
1、启动pgAdmin4并连接到你的PostgreSQL服务器。选择目标数据库:在左侧的浏览树中,找到并展开你的服务器节点。找到你想要导入SQL文件的数据库,并展开该数据库节点以显示其内容。在数据库节点下,找到并展开“模式”节点,然后选择“public”模式。
2、将SQL文件导入PostgreSQL数据库的详细步骤如下: 确认导入方式使用psql命令行工具:适用于直接导入.sql格式的文本文件。使用pg_restore工具:适用于导入.dump格式的备份文件(通常由pg_dump生成),支持并行操作以提高性能。
3、假设SQL文件名为procedures_and_functions.sql,在MySQL命令行客户端中,先切换到目标数据库,然后执行命令SOURCE procedures_and_functions.sql; ,即可将文件中的存储过程和函数定义导入到当前数据库。PostgreSQL:使用i命令。
4、一,执行SQL语句 示例代码如下:SET DB_NAME=TEMP C:\Program Files\PostgreSQL\0\bin\psql.exe -h localhost -U postgres -d %db_NAME% -p 5432 -w -c SELECT * FROM TABLE1;二,执行SQL脚本文件 在SQL语句比较复杂时,可以先把SQL语句保存到文件中,然后用psql.exe执行该文件。
5、首先,需要导入psycopg2库,并使用它来建立与PostgreSQL数据库的连接。连接时需要提供数据库的主机名、端口号、数据库名、用户名和密码。
...数据库可视化工具HeidiSQL连接MySQL和PostgreSQL
首先,需要从HeidiSQL的官方网站下载并安装该工具。HeidiSQL的下载地址为:https:// 下载完成后,按照安装向导的提示进行安装。安装完成后,桌面上会出现HeidiSQL的图标。使用HeidiSQL连接MySQL数据库 打开HeidiSQL:双击桌面上的HeidiSQL图标,打开该工具。

运行安装程序右键点击下载的文件,选择 安装,进入安装界面。HeidiSQL 支持 MySQL、SQL Server、PostgreSQL 等数据库,点击 Next 后勾选 I accept the agreement,选择安装目录(默认或自定义)。配置安装选项安装过程中可选择创建开始菜单、桌面快捷方式、关联 .SQL 文件、自动更新等选项。
HeidiSQL:一款高效的免费数据库管理工具 HeidiSQL 是一款免费的图形化数据库管理工具,它支持多种数据库类型,包括 MySQL、MariaDB、Microsoft SQL、PostgreSQL、SQLite、Interbase 以及 Firebird。目前,这款工具只能在 Windows 平台使用。
PostgreSQL数据库使用
1、从开始程序中找到PostgreSQL,然后启动pgAdmin III。这是PostgreSQL的图形化管理工具。连接到服务器 打开pgAdmin III后,你会看到软件的主页面。双击数据库,然后输入postgres密码来连接到服务器。保存密码(可选)在弹出的指导性建议-保存密码对话框中,点击“确定”以保存密码,方便后续使用。
2、PostgreSQL数据库执行查询语句的方法如下:全字段查询:使用SELECT * FROM 表名可查询表中所有字段信息,但表数据量大时不建议使用。指定字段查询:通过SELECT 字段1,字段2 FROM 表名可查询表中特定字段信息。条件查询:使用WHERE子句指定查询条件,如SELECT * FROM 表名 WHERE 条件,可精确筛选结果。
3、常见陷阱与解决方案未提交事务:修改数据后未调用commit(),导致数据未持久化。解决:始终在修改操作后显式提交。SQL注入风险:直接拼接SQL字符串(如fSELECT * FROM table WHERE id = {user_input})。解决:始终使用参数化查询(%s占位符)。
4、进入容器并连接 PostgreSQL:docker exec -it postgres psql -U postgres 关键参数说明--name postgres:指定容器名称为 postgres。-e POSTGRES_PASSWORD=mysecretpassword:设置数据库密码为 mysecretpassword(需替换为强密码)。-p 5432:5432:将宿主机的 5432 端口映射到容器的 5432 端口。
5、在PostgreSQL数据库中,视图的使用方法包括创建、查看、使用临时视图及自定义列名等操作,具体步骤如下:创建视图PostgreSQL中视图的定义与其他数据库一致,均为创建虚拟表。
6、在Navicat中,选择“新建”——“PostgreSQL”。设置连接名、主机(填写10.1)、端口(填写PostgreSQL监听的端口5432)、初始数据库(填写postgres)。输入前面新建数据库用户的用户名和密码。配置SSH通道 在连接的“SSH”页面中,选择使用SSH通道。输入群晖的SSH连接信息,包括IP、用户名和密码。
上一篇:关于PostgreSQL时间戳毫秒,如何精确查询及转换?
栏 目:PostgreSQL
下一篇:VC PostgreSQL,这款数据库管理系统为何如此简单易用,它有哪些独特之处?
本文标题:为何在使用postgresql时,无法正确显示数据库表详细信息?
本文地址:https://fushidao.cc/shujuku/58123.html
您可能感兴趣的文章
- 02-26请问包含哪些关键词的词条会涉及postgresql数据扩展名?
- 02-26我国在postgresql国产替代方面有哪些进展和挑战?
- 02-26关于PostgreSQL列标志,这些关键信息你了解多少?
- 02-26为何我的PostgreSQL连接速度如此缓慢?常见原因及优化方法解析
- 02-26如何快速上手使用PostgreSQL工具?详细入门教程揭秘!
- 02-26关于PostgreSQL时间类型的最小可能值,您知道多少?
- 02-26如何构建包含PostgreSQL存储过程与事务处理的完整词条示例?
- 02-26如何全面掌握使用postgresql客户端工具的详细教程及技巧?
- 02-26苹果电脑macOS下如何通过命令行安装PostgreSQL而非Postman?
- 02-25如何实现 PostgreSQL 数据库的简单扩容策略?详细解析与疑问解答
阅读排行
- 1请问包含哪些关键词的词条会涉及postgresql数据扩展名?
- 2我国在postgresql国产替代方面有哪些进展和挑战?
- 3关于PostgreSQL列标志,这些关键信息你了解多少?
- 4为何我的PostgreSQL连接速度如此缓慢?常见原因及优化方法解析
- 5如何快速上手使用PostgreSQL工具?详细入门教程揭秘!
- 6关于PostgreSQL时间类型的最小可能值,您知道多少?
- 7如何构建包含PostgreSQL存储过程与事务处理的完整词条示例?
- 8如何全面掌握使用postgresql客户端工具的详细教程及技巧?
- 9苹果电脑macOS下如何通过命令行安装PostgreSQL而非Postman?
- 10如何实现 PostgreSQL 数据库的简单扩容策略?详细解析与疑问解答
推荐教程
- 09-22navicat连接postgresql、人大金仓等数据库报错解决办法
- 02-01PostgreSQL和MySQL到底有什么区别?开发者必看对比指南
- 09-22PostgreSQL设置主键自增的方法详解
- 09-22postgresql查询今天、昨天、本周、本月、上月、今年、去年的时间以及计算时间之差
- 09-22在PostgreSQL中实现跨数据库的关联查询
- 09-22使用python-slim镜像遇到无法使用PostgreSQL的问题及解决方法
- 09-22Postgres copy命令导入导出数据的操作方法
- 02-01PostgreSQL客户端工具大揭秘,哪种最适合你的数据库管理需求?
- 01-31PostgreSQL下载指南,如何获取最新稳定版本?
- 09-22postgresql 日期查询最全整理
